What impact has war in Ukraine had on its people, and what challenges do they face building a new life they weren't looking for?

Today David talks to Diana Kocheva, founder of the London Tech Community
Diana didn't want to leave Ukraine. Kyiv was the perfect city and her home. Yet war forced her to relocate and she's spent the last two years constantly working to help others in her community. What is the mental toll? What has she does to protect her own sense of self? What are her hopes for the future? How can she help those in a similar position and how do we view refugees in our society?
